Publication number: 20140200956Abstract: A computer-implemented method for collecting consumer information, including receiving a plurality of images of consumers; identifying at plurality of consumer characteristics from the images of consumers; and storing the identified characteristics in a consumer information database. Consumer characteristics include consumer age, race, weight, height, information regarding clothing worn by consumer (brand, style, type, color, etc.), body temperature, amount of time spent in a location, travel path through a location, time spent in proximity to a particular product, and/or identification of a product considered but not purchased. The method may include receiving information from a point of sale device and storing the received information and/or generating an advertisement, an alert regarding a consumer travel pattern within a location, a list of products that share one or more consumer characteristics, and/or at least one of a survey and coupon for a product not purchased.Type: ApplicationFiled: December 20, 2013Publication date: July 17, 2014Applicant: EMINVENT, LLCInventor: Seth Gerszberg
